Skip to Content

Smooth closings & smart audits: Simplifying the accounting cycle

Duration: 26:11


PART 1 — Analytical Summary 🚀

Context 💼

A member of the Odoo Accounting product team introduced a new feature called Smart Audit in a 26-minute session focused on streamlining accounting closings and audits. The talk framed a broader industry shift: less time on manual bookkeeping thanks to OCR and AI, and more emphasis on compliance, fiscal checks, and advisory services. The core problem: teams waste time juggling fragmented Excel checklists outside their accounting system. Odoo’s response is a fully integrated audit workflow inside Odoo Accounting, connecting reviews, controls, documents, and journal entries end-to-end.

Core Ideas & Innovations 🧠

The new feature centers on a dedicated Review menu and a Working File that consolidates the audit process for a given period. An audit combines two dimensions: “cycles” (e.g., Fixed Assets, Inventory, Sales) and “balances” (accounts to review), each with its own progress tracking. Odoo ships with default checks—both generic and localization-specific—while allowing firms to tailor and automate their own.

In the demo, the speaker showed a realistic collaboration between a bookkeeper and a supervisor. The bookkeeper creates audits by period (with the last fiscal period suggested by default), runs through checks, uploads evidence, flags anomalies, and communicates via the built-in chatter. Checks have states (e.g., Reviewed, Supervised, Anomaly), and some are automated: the system evaluates internal rules and updates statuses automatically. The supervisor filters only items needing attention, validates cycles once all checks are at least reviewed, and moves to the balances view to assess account-level reasonableness. The balances view includes contextual alerts—for example, a warning if an asset account carries a negative balance—helping reviewers spot potential misclassifications quickly. Notes and decisions are logged and tied to the underlying entries and reports, reinforcing traceability.

Configuration is flexible. In developer mode, teams can define new Return Types (audits) and create new checks—manual, automated (with rule domains on models like Journal Entries), or document uploads. The system supports mass setup via import, making it practical to migrate existing checklists. Automated checks can trigger Odubot updates, moving items to “reviewed” once conditions are satisfied (e.g., no draft entries remain). Localization is a priority: the product includes a generic audit checklist and is progressively expanding country-specific checks. As an example, the speaker confirmed robust support for Moroccan localization (chart of accounts, default taxes, fiscal reports).

Impact & Takeaways ⚙️💬

This release brings auditors and accountants into a single, connected workflow, eliminating off-system checklists and the reconciliation work they entail. The result is smoother closings, stronger compliance, and faster reviews. Automatic checks increase coverage while saving time; the audit trail (chatter, attachments, state transitions) strengthens traceability. Multiple audits per period are supported (e.g., a dedicated payroll audit), and statuses intelligently re-open if source data changes—ensuring reviews stay current. While today the Review menu targets the Bookkeeper role and above, external auditor access and more granular permissions are a work in progress. Formal “audit assertions” (e.g., completeness) aren’t hardcoded, but reviewers can annotate reports and balances, syncing commentary into financial statements for narrative context.

The bottom line: Smart Audit turns Odoo Accounting into a practical, integrated hub for closings and audits—reducing manual effort and making compliance checks both repeatable and adaptable to local rules and firm-specific practices.

PART 2 — Viewpoint: Odoo Perspective

Disclaimer: AI-generated creative perspective inspired by Odoo's vision.

We’ve always believed that great software removes busywork so people can focus on advice, not admin. Smart Audit continues that journey. By connecting checks, documents, and journal entries in one place, we reduce switching costs and make the review process more reliable and transparent.

The community will help us take localization even further. Each country’s specifics matter in accounting, and our modular approach lets partners and users bring local rules into a simple, integrated workflow. The goal isn’t more features for their own sake—it’s fewer steps, fewer spreadsheets, and more clarity during the close.

PART 3 — Viewpoint: Competitors (SAP / Microsoft / Others)

Disclaimer: AI-generated fictional commentary. Not an official corporate statement.

Odoo’s Smart Audit demonstrates strong UX thinking: integrated checklists, automated validations, and in-context collaboration all help reduce friction in the close. For midmarket teams looking to move away from spreadsheets, this is a compelling step toward operationalizing compliance within the ERP.

At enterprise scale, customers will also evaluate depth in areas like segregation of duties, SOX-ready workflows, evidence retention and attestation models, auditor portals, and governance for rule changes across multiple entities. Performance on very large datasets, consolidation scenarios, and regulatory frameworks (e.g., industry-specific or multi-jurisdictional) will be critical differentiation points. If Odoo continues to harden these layers while preserving its streamlined UX, it will increasingly challenge incumbents in the upper midmarket.

Disclaimer: This article contains AI-generated summaries and fictionalized commentaries for illustrative purposes. Viewpoints labeled as "Odoo Perspective" or "Competitors" are simulated and do not represent any real statements or positions. All product names and trademarks belong to their respective owners.

Share this post
Archive
Sign in to leave a comment
Simplifying global reporting with Odoo’s embedded data and spreadsheets